首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Django从视图创建和输出txt文件

Django是一个基于Python的开源Web应用框架,它提供了丰富的功能和工具,使得Web开发变得更加高效和简单。在Django中,视图是处理用户请求的代码逻辑部分,它接收来自用户的请求,处理数据并生成响应。

要从视图中创建和输出txt文件,可以按照以下步骤进行:

  1. 创建一个视图函数: 首先,需要在Django项目中的某个应用中创建一个视图函数。可以在views.py文件中定义一个新的函数,用于处理创建和输出txt文件的逻辑。例如:
  2. 创建一个视图函数: 首先,需要在Django项目中的某个应用中创建一个视图函数。可以在views.py文件中定义一个新的函数,用于处理创建和输出txt文件的逻辑。例如:
  3. 配置URL路由: 在Django项目的应用中,需要将上述视图函数与URL进行映射,以便能够通过URL访问到该视图。在应用的urls.py文件中添加相应的URL配置。例如:
  4. 配置URL路由: 在Django项目的应用中,需要将上述视图函数与URL进行映射,以便能够通过URL访问到该视图。在应用的urls.py文件中添加相应的URL配置。例如:
  5. 上述配置将使得当用户访问/create_txt/路径时,会触发create_txt_file视图函数。
  6. 运行项目: 在完成上述代码编写后,可以运行Django项目,启动Web服务器。使用命令python manage.py runserver在本地启动开发服务器。
  7. 访问视图: 在浏览器中输入http://localhost:8000/create_txt/,即可访问到create_txt_file视图函数,并生成一个txt文件,浏览器会自动下载。

这样,当用户访问create_txt/路径时,Django将执行create_txt_file视图函数,该函数会生成一个包含"Hello, world!"内容的txt文件,并返回给用户下载。

推荐的腾讯云相关产品:

  • 云服务器(CVM):提供弹性可扩展的云服务器实例,用于运行和部署Django项目。链接地址:https://cloud.tencent.com/product/cvm
  • 对象存储(COS):用于存储和管理生成的txt文件。链接地址:https://cloud.tencent.com/product/cos
  • 云安全中心(SSC):提供全面的安全解决方案,保护云计算环境和应用的安全。链接地址:https://cloud.tencent.com/product/ssc

请注意,以上提到的腾讯云产品仅为示例,并非对其他云计算品牌商的替代。在实际情况中,可以根据具体需求选择适合的云计算品牌商和相关产品。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券